Why Is My Jewelry Causing Skin Discoloration?
In some cases, certain types of jewelry can cause a slight discoloration on the skin, often appearing as a green or dark tint. This is a common and harmless reaction. This typically happens when metals (such as copper or metal alloys) react with:. Fo
